On 21 April 2024, the tanker "ROSSI A. DESGAGNES", with 20 people on board and while under the conduct of a pilot, reported having sustained a total failure of its engine causing a loss of propulsion upon departure from section 109 of Port de Montréal, QC. The crew addressed the issue and the vessel proceeded to a nearby anchorage to conduct an in-depth inquiry.
On 19 August 2022, the product/chemical tanker "ROSSI A. DESGAGNES" reported sustaining a main engine failure off Les Escoumins, QC. The vessel proceeded to the nearest anchorage for repairs.
On 09 January 2021, the chemical/oil product tanker "ROSSI A. DESGAGNES" experienced a problem with its steering system near Saint-Laurent-de-l'île-d'Orléans, QC. The vessel proceeded to the nearest anchorage. The crew carried out repairs and the vessel later resumed its voyage.
On 26 September 2020, the tanker "ROSSI A. DESGAGNES", under the conduct of a pilot, reported a close quarters situation with 2 jet skis off Deschaillons-sur-Saint-Laurent, QC.
On 04 August 2020, the chemical product tanker "ROSSI A. DESGAGNES", under the conduct of a pilot, reported a main engine failure 25 nautical miles NE of Quebec City, QC. The vessel dropped anchor near buoy K-111 and the crew carried out repairs.
Recorded marine occurrences naming this vessel.
